## Formula sandbox tuning

User-supplied formulas in Gridmoor execute inside a restricted interpreter with hard ceilings on time, memory, and call depth. Reviewers should confirm any change to these ceilings is justified in the PR description, since raising them widens the abuse surface. Defaults were chosen from production traces. The current limits are as follows.

limits module of tafog-fawip:
WEIGHTS = {
    "julix": 57,
    "lamys": 992,
    "kasvan": 209,
    "quenok": 750,
    "alddor": 259,
    "oliath": 1009,
    "wenix": 815,
}

## Item 7.3 — Digest Scheduling

Verify the Mailbarrow batch digest scheduler enforces per-tenant send windows. Confirm cron definitions are stored read-only, changes require dual approval, and retries cap at three. Check logs exclude recipient content. Evidence: config export plus last quarter's change records. The accountable owner is named below.

account owner for bawip-tahag: Raleth Quenok

**Runbook: Crumbline account recovery — order-cutoff rule**

Plugin authors: Crumbline locks bakery orders at the 14:00 local cutoff. Recovery requests submitted after cutoff queue for the next window; do not retry. Verify the shop's timezone field first — most failures are misconfigured zones, not auth. If the account is genuinely locked, escalate via the recovery flow and supply the passphrase below.

unlock words, bagaf-yahog: istwyn-gilox